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
442 574832173 7583 8871129 135666
5962066 64558 9844
5962066 64558 9844
6553 52679 08944949 268970
All about undefined
Interested in learning more?
5962066 64558 9844
6553 52679 08944949 268970
See more
5696949098 3882789896
769609 2488 441691
See more
53802301910 39537442865
3282528 696 76
See more